Northwest of the historic Powder House Square, Teele Square is a small community within walking distance of Tufts University. Teele Square has quick access to several excellent schools, including one of the top Catholic schools in Massachusetts in the western part of the neighborhood, making it a great location for families. The area features triple-decker, multiple-family units and apartment complexes available for rent.
There are delicious, independently-owned restaurants and charming cafes along Broadway and Holland Streets, which run through the center of Teele Square. For a unique coffee experience, visit Knights Moves Café, a board game café serving strong espresso and yummy sandwiches. Commercial hub Davis Square, right on the southern border of Teele Square, offers access to even more eateries and a movie theater.
Teele Square is a great location for students and professors looking for housing close to campus. Conveniently, along with Tufts University a brief walk away, Teele Square is only a 10 minute drive from Harvard University and Lesley University. Great for commuters as well, the neighborhood is only 30 minutes from Boston. Essentially, Teele Square is a great area for anyone.
